Roundup: China's Zhu Lin edged out with narrow loss, Yang/Chan advance in women's doubles

MELBOURNE, Jan. 22 (Xinhua) -- On day six of the Australian Open, China's Zhu Lin was edged 4-6, 6-1, 6-4 by the 24th-seeded and former Grand Slam winner Victoria Azarenka of Belarus, while Yang Zhaoxuan and her partner of Chinese Taipei Chan Hao-ching reached the third round in women's doubles with a straight-set win.

"It was a super tough match. I'm really exhausted. I mean I gave everything out there, and I'm really proud of myself," Zhu told reporters after the match.
